Jacksonville,
Florida, located near the Northeast coast, is a vibrant city known
for its diverse culture, scenic waterfronts and growing economy. As
the largest city by area in the continental U.S., Jacksonville
offers an array of outdoor activities including 22 miles of
beaches, world-class fishing, the scenic St. Johns River and
numerous parks and nature preserves. Enjoy our historic
neighborhoods, eclectic museums, coastal cuisine and delicious
craft beer, The city has a thriving arts and entertainment scene,
and its urban core hosts a variety of festivals, live music and
sports events, including NFL games with the Jacksonville Jaguars.
Jacksonville's economy is driven by sectors like healthcare,
finance, logistics, and technology, making it an attractive
location for both businesses and residents seeking affordable
living and ample job opportunities.
